Take a train or bus to travel 133 miles (215 km) to Venice from Innsbruck. The most popular travel companies which serve this journey are FlixBus or Deutsche Bahn among others. Travelers can even take a direct bus or train from Innsbruck to Venice.

There are 2 options to travel to Venice from Innsbruck including taking a train or bus.
The cheapest way to go to Venice from Innsbruck is by taking a bus, which costs on average $20 (€18).
This is compared to other ways of getting from Innsbruck to Venice:
Taking a bus costs $11 (€10) less than taking a train, which costs on average $31 (€28) for the same trip.
The fastest way to get to Venice from Innsbruck is by train with an average travel time of 4 h 17 min.
Other travel options to Venice take longer:
Getting to Venice by bus takes 5 h 25 min on average.
The distance is approximately 133 miles (215 km) from Innsbruck to Venice.
The average frequency per day from Innsbruck to Venice is:
- Around 5 buses per day.
- 4 trains per day.
However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route from Innsbruck to Venice as scheduled services by train or bus can vary by season or day of the week.
These are the most popular departure and arrival points when traveling from Innsbruck to Venice:
- Most travelers board their train from Innsbruck Hbf and arrive in Venice Santa Lucia.

Yes, there are direct routes from Innsbruck to Venice with the following travel companies:
- You can check for a direct bus to Venice with FlixBus with 2 direct buses per day.
- You can find 3 direct trains per day to Venice with Deutsche Bahn or ÖBB | Euro City (EC).
Direct services to Venice tend to save you time and add more convenience as you won't need to transfer at another stop in between, so it's worth paying attention to before booking tickets for your trip.
